| namespace content { |
| |
| class WebContents; |
| |
| class SynchronousCompositorClient; |
| |
| struct CONTENT_EXPORT SynchronousCompositorMemoryPolicy { |
| // Memory limit for rendering and pre-rendering. |
| size_t bytes_limit; |
| |
| // Limit of number of GL resources used for rendering and pre-rendering. |
| size_t num_resources_limit; |
| |
| SynchronousCompositorMemoryPolicy(); |
| }; |
| |
| // Interface for embedders that wish to direct compositing operations |
| // synchronously under their own control. Only meaningful when the |
| // kEnableSyncrhonousRendererCompositor flag is specified. |
| class CONTENT_EXPORT SynchronousCompositor { |
| public: |
| // Must be called once per WebContents instance. Will create the compositor |
| // instance as needed, but only if |client| is non-NULL. |
| static void SetClientForWebContents(WebContents* contents, |
| SynchronousCompositorClient* client); |
| |
| // Allows changing or resetting the client to NULL (this must be used if |
| // the client is being deleted prior to the DidDestroyCompositor() call |
| // being received by the client). Ownership of |client| remains with |
| // the caller. |
| virtual void SetClient(SynchronousCompositorClient* client) = 0; |
| |
| // Synchronously initialize compositor for hardware draw. Can only be called |
| // while compositor is in software only mode, either after compositor is |
| // first created or after ReleaseHwDraw is called. It is invalid to |
| // DemandDrawHw before this returns true. |surface| is the GLSurface that |
| // should be used to create the underlying hardware context. |
| virtual bool InitializeHwDraw(scoped_refptr<gfx::GLSurface> surface) = 0; |
| |
| // Reverse of InitializeHwDraw above. Can only be called while hardware draw |
| // is already initialized. Brings compositor back to software only mode and |
| // releases all hardware resources. |
| virtual void ReleaseHwDraw() = 0; |
| |
| // "On demand" hardware draw. The content is first clipped to |damage_area|, |
| // then transformed through |transform|, and finally clipped to |view_size| |
| // and by the existing stencil buffer if any. |
| virtual bool DemandDrawHw( |
| gfx::Size surface_size, |
| const gfx::Transform& transform, |
| gfx::Rect viewport, |
| gfx::Rect clip, |
| bool stencil_enabled) = 0; |
| |
| // "On demand" SW draw, into the supplied canvas (observing the transform |
| // and clip set there-in). |
| virtual bool DemandDrawSw(SkCanvas* canvas) = 0; |
| |
| // Set the memory limit policy of this compositor. |
| virtual void SetMemoryPolicy( |
| const SynchronousCompositorMemoryPolicy& policy) = 0; |
| |
| // Should be called by the embedder after the embedder had modified the |
| // scroll offset of the root layer (as returned by |
| // SynchronousCompositorClient::GetTotalRootLayerScrollOffset). |
| virtual void DidChangeRootLayerScrollOffset() = 0; |
| |
| protected: |
| virtual ~SynchronousCompositor() {} |
| }; |
| |
| } // namespace content |
